2º ESO Advan. Unit 6
Health
| Term | Definition |
|---|---|
| Headache | Pathologya pain located in the head |
| Beating | The receiving of strokes from someone who beats: |
| Breathing | The act of a person or other animal that breathes; respiration |
| Exercise regularly | Regular activity or exertion, esp. for the sake of practice, training, or improvement |
| Lose weight | Slim down |
| Focus | A central point, such as of attraction, attention, or activity |
| Stressed | Physical, mental, or emotional strain that disturbs one's normal bodily functions |
| Stressful | A situation that makes you feel flustered |
| Take deep breaths | Breath slowly |
| Gain weight | Put on weight |
| Panic attack | An episode of suffering from anxiety |
| Under pressure | When you feel overwhelmed by a situation. |
| Blood | The red fluid that flows through the heart throughout the body. |
| Brain | The mass of nerve tissue in the head of humans and animals that is the center of the nervous system. |
| Chest | The front portion of the body enclosed by the ribs; thorax |
| Muscles | A tissue in the body made up of long cells that can contract, causing movement of the body. |
| Throat | The top of the passage from the mouth to the stomach and lungs |
| Stomach | A saclike part of the body where food is stored and partially digested |
| Lungs | Either of the two saclike organs used for breathing in the chest of humans and air-breathing animals |
| Bones | One of the parts of the skeleton of an animal's body |
| Skin | The tissue that is the outer covering of a human or animal body, esp. when it is soft and flexible |
| Heart | A muscular organ in humans and many animals that receives blood from the veins and pumps it through the arteries to other parts of the body |
